I fill an empty array with form values in a single view, 
how am I able to pass this array into a new view so that I can do what I 
want with the values in the new controller after the form is submitted? 


I try doing something like the following within my controller containing 
the form:

if form.process().accepted:
redirect(URL('default', 'nextstep', 'vals=vals')

where vals is the array that I filled from that view, this gives me a 
ticket saying global variable vals is not defined when I try using it in 
the nextstep controller...so I am not passing it correctly.

def nextstep():
return dict(vals=vals)

P.S. This array is filled a specific way after the values are acquired from 
form.vars so this is why I need to figure out how to pass the new array 
*vals* into a new controller..
